Key Features
- DirectFlame cooking creates searing, browning, and crisping
- Full grate sear zone puts more food on the flame
- Rapid React PID controller heats up fast and regains temp when lid is opened
- SmokeBoost setting intensifies smoky flavor

I got the Searwood specifically to replace my old masterbuilt smoker and a month in I'm impressed it. I've primarily used this for smoking (still using my Weber Genesis and Weber kettle for gas/charcoal grilling) I watched several reviews of the unit all of the reviewers hit on the same notes: really easy to use, easy to clean, modular, excellent tech (love the USB-C connectivity for the control unit). I've smoked rib, wings, sausages and finally the big test, brisket and all exceeded my expectations. The only minor issues I've noticed so far (and they are super minor) are: 1) wish we could remote start the unit from the app 2) would have liked to had 360 degree wheeled casters on all 4 legs 3) there is some fit/finish issues when I was assembling my grill (some of the screws won't fit flush) Overall, very satisfied with my purchase and am happy with it.

When will my item arrive?
Once shipped, items usually arrive within 3-5 business days. While UPS and FedEx are our carriers for smaller items, be aware that larger items and orders are shipped via freight. The freight process is a bit more complicated than what we've all come to expect for small parcels, so it's important that you're prepared and understand what's required of you well before delivery day.
- Most freight products ship on a pallet
- Some carriers will call to schedule a delivery window, while others will deliver the shipment to a reasonably accessible location closest to your residence (their goal is to deliver as near a garage door as they can).
- We'll specify which process you can expect in your shipping confirmation email.
For carriers that schedule delivery appointments:
Carriers that schedule delivery appointments require you to be home for delivery and provide your signature. The delivery is made with a semi-truck with lift gate services, and the shipment is dropped off at the curb. If you authorize the shipping company to leave the delivery without a signature, BBQGuys can't be held responsible for damages that occur during delivery. As complicated as this process may seem, we've only scratched the surface here — please review our detailed guide to freight delivery so there are no surprises when a freight shipment heads your way.
For carriers that deliver without an appointment:
Carriers that deliver without an appointment don't require you to be home or set up a delivery window, and you aren't required to sign for the pallet(s). Instead of scheduling an appointment, arranging your schedule to be home for the delivery, and signing to confirm receipt, you can sit back and let your items come to you. If you're home at the time of the drop-off, you can request the driver place your delivery in the garage; if you're out of the house, the driver will leave it near the garage or doorstep.
